The Postgraduate Certificate in Visual Storytelling for Sustainable Practices is a comprehensive course that emphasizes the importance of visual storytelling in promoting sustainable practices. This course is designed to meet the growing industry demand for professionals who can effectively communicate complex sustainability concepts through visual media.

About this course

Through this course, learners will develop essential skills in visual design, data visualization, animation, and filmmaking, all with a focus on sustainability. These skills are critical for career advancement in a variety of fields, including marketing, communications, environmental science, and urban planning. By the end of the course, learners will be able to create compelling visual stories that engage audiences, promote sustainable practices, and drive positive change. The Postgraduate Certificate in Visual Storytelling for Sustainable Practices is an increasingly popular program in the UK, with various exciting career opportunities. This section showcases a 3D Pie chart representing the job market trends for roles related to this program. 1. Data Scientist: With a 25% share, data scientists leverage mathematical and computational skills to analyze and interpret complex information to support decision-making in sustainable practices. 2. Sustainability Consultant: Holding 20% of the market, sustainability consultants guide businesses in implementing environmentally friendly practices and lowering their carbon footprint. 3. Environmental Engineer: With a 15% share, environmental engineers design systems and solutions that protect and preserve the environment, utilizing technology and scientific principles. 4. Policy Analyst: A 14% share is assigned to policy analysts who research, evaluate, and formulate sustainable policies to influence government decisions. 5. Communications Specialist: These professionals, taking up 13% of the market, excel in conveying complex sustainable ideas to the public through various media channels. 6. Educator: With a 13% share, educators play a crucial role in sharing knowledge and fostering curiosity in students about sustainable practices. These roles reflect the diverse opportunities available to graduates of the Postgraduate Certificate in Visual Storytelling for Sustainable Practices in the UK.
